TY - M-10104 AU - hemnani, Sarita AU - Bhatt, Tanvi TI - Harnessing Generative AI to Transform Economic Research: Insights and Practical Applications T2 - Scientific Research Journal of Business, Management and Accounting PY - 2024 VL - 2 IS - 1 SN - 2584-0592 AB - Generative artificial intelligence (AI), especially large language models (LLMs) like ChatGPT, offers tremendous promise for economic analysis. In this paper, we look at six main areas where LLMs might be helpful to economists: brainstorming and suggestions, writing, studies and background, data analysis, coding, and algebraic derivations. The study proposes that economists may significantly increase their efficiency by scripting micro-tasks using generative AI and provides concrete implementation instances by classifying LLM capabilities from experimental to very helpful. Cognitive automation driven by AI will have far-reaching consequences for economics in the future since productivity increases are directly proportional to the rate of AI system performance improvement.
